What landscaping work pairs well with tree removal in South Louisiana?
After removal, many Baton Rouge homeowners opt for shade-tolerant ground cover, new sod in areas that now get more sun, or smaller ornamental trees that won't create the same risk profile as a large water oak. A provider who does both can advise based on what you already have growing.
How much does tree removal typically cost in Baton Rouge?
Costs vary widely based on tree height, trunk diameter, proximity to structures, and access to the site. Small trees may run a few hundred dollars while large, difficult removals can reach into the thousands. An on-site estimate is the only way to get a reliable number.

What's canopy lifting and does it help with storm resistance?
Canopy lifting means removing the lower branches of a tree to raise the height at which the canopy begins, which improves visibility, allows more light underneath, and can reduce wind resistance during storms. It doesn't replace structural pruning but is a common and useful technique for Louisiana trees.
How do I prepare my yard before a tree service crew arrives?
Clear any outdoor furniture, vehicles, or decorations from the work area and make sure the crew has clear access to the tree and an exit route for equipment. Let them know about any underground irrigation lines or buried utilities so they can work around them safely.
